In a normal cardiac cycle if stroke volume is 50 ml then what would be thecardiac output​

Answer»

The CARDIAC output of an individual can by calculated by the product of stroke VOLUME and HEART beat. Normally, the heart beats 72 times per minute.According to the question the stroke volume is 50ml.Cardiac output = 50ml × 72 = 3600ml.thus, the cardiac output is 3600ml.Note : During cardiac cycle, each ventricle pumps out approximately 70ml of BLOOD which is called the stroke volume. The cardiac output can be defined as the volume of blood pumped out by each ventricle per minute . The body has the ability to alter the stroke volume as well as the heart RATE. The cardiac output of an athlete will be much higher than of ordinary man.
